GreenPower's Clean Sheet Design
GreenPower offers a unique all-aluminum class 4 battery electric chassis and cab. This platform is not just the basis for the company's EV Star Mobility Plus all-aluminum body minibus, but also an OEM platform that permits truck, bus and vocational vehicle builders to put their bodies on it to build custom-designed vehicles that meet their specific needs.
Greenpower's clean sheet design method allows for optimal battery pack placement and weight distribution which allows it to provide more energy sources and provide a greater distance and set a new standard for zero-emissions student transportation. This is a key distinction from the traditional Type A school bus which is typically a body-on chassis.
The BEAST is a 40-foot, fully-compliant, zero emission Type D electric school bus that has seating for up to 90 people and a unified aluminum body built on a strong steel truss chassis. Its flat floor design, which is safe for a crash allows dual port charging and supports both DC fast charging and Level 2 charging.
This specially designed chassis allows Greenpower to maximize space for cargo and students which is crucial for the future of freight and passenger transport. The lightweight and corrosion-resistant body of the BEAST helps to reduce maintenance costs.

GreenPower's Vehicles

GreenPower Motor Company designs and builds a full suite of electric medium and heavy-duty vehicles like school buses, transit shuttles, buses cargo vans, the chassis and cab. They have an uncluttered design approach and incorporate global suppliers for key components. They are designed for batteries, no emissions and are the most secure available.
The company's EV Star utility truck is built for mid to last-mile delivery of temperature-sensitive goods. The truck can carry the capacity to carry 7,000 pounds and a range up to 150 miles. Clean-sheet design makes it easier to achieve an optimal placement of the battery pack, allowing it to have a better battery weight distribution than traditional trucks.
In June 2024, GreenPower launched the EV Star REEFERX, a state-of-the-art all-electric refrigerated truck for fleets that need to transport temperature-sensitive goods efficiently. The new EV Star REEFERX has an advanced cooling system, exclusive battery management systems, and an integrated driver's interface. This lets drivers monitor vehicle performance in real-time including energy consumption as well as the status of the vehicle.

The company's EV Star Cab & Chassis is a completely electric commercial platform that is able to accommodate various upgrades and bodies that can be used in multiple cases. The chassis and cab have a payload capacity of 7,700 pounds, and a range up to 150 miles and are engineered to meet the various requirements of a wide range of customers. The EV Star can be ordered with a variety of batteries to meet the distinct needs of each application.
